hu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Kubernetes容器编排平台,现代应用的基石|kubernetes pause容器,Kubernetes容器编排平台

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

Kubernetes作为Linux操作系统上的容器编排平台,已成为现代应用部署的关键技术。它通过自动化容器部署、扩展和管理,提高了应用的可伸缩性和可靠性。Kubernetes的pause容器是其核心组件之,用于创建和管理Pod的基础结构,确保容器间的网络和存储资源共享。该平台简化了复杂应用的运维流程,使得开发和运维团队能够更高效地协作,推动企业数字化转型。

在当今的云计算和微服务架构时代,容器技术已经成为企业数字化转型的重要工具,而在这个领域,Kubernetes无疑是最为闪耀的明星,作为一款开源的容器编排平台,Kubernetes以其强大的功能、灵活性和可扩展性,成为了现代应用部署和管理的不选择。

Kubernetes的起源与发展

Kubernetes最初由Google设计并开发,并于2014年开源,它的设计灵感来源于Google内部使用的Borg系统,旨在解决大规模容器集群管理的复杂性问题,随着容器技术的普及,Kubernetes迅速得到了业界的广泛认可和支持,成为了容器编排领域的事实标准。

核心功能与优势

1、自动化部署与回滚:Kubernetes支持声明式配置,用户只需描述期望的状态,平台会自动将应用部署到目标环境,并在出现问题时自动回滚到稳定版本。

2、服务发现与负载均衡:Kubernetes可以为容器提供自己的IP地址和DNS名,并自动进行负载均衡,确保服务的高可用性。

3、存储编排:支持多种存储后端,如本地存储、公有云存储等,用户可以根据需求灵活选择。

4、自我修复:当容器失败时,Kubernetes会自动重启容器;当所部署的Node宕机时,会将容器重新调度到其他Node上。

5、密钥与配置管理:提供Secret和ConfigMap机制,方便管理应用的敏感信息和配置。

Kubernetes架构解析

Kubernetes的架构由多个组件组成,主要包括:

Master节点:负责管理和控制整个集群,包括API Server、Scheduler、Controller Manager等核心组件。

Node节点:运行实际应用的容器,每个Node上都有Kubelet、Kube-proxy等组件。

Pod:Kubernetes中最小的部署单元,一个Pod可以包含一个多个容器,它们共享网络和存储资源。

应用场景与实践

1、微服务架构:Kubernetes非常适合微服务架构的部署和管理,每个微服务可以作为一个独立的Pod进行部署,便于管理和扩展。

2、持续集成与持续交付(CI/CD):通过与Jenkins、GitLab等CI/CD工具集成,可以实现应用的自动化构建、测试和部署。

3、大数据处理:Kubernetes可以用于大数据处理任务,如Spark、Hadoop等,提供高效的资源调度和管理。

4、边缘计算:在边缘计算场景中,Kubernetes可以帮助企业在边缘节点上高效部署和管理应用。

Kubernetes的挑战与应对

尽管Kubernetes功能强大,但在实际应用中也面临一些挑战:

学习曲线陡峭:Kubernetes的复杂性和概念众多,初学者需要花费较多时间学习。

运维复杂:集群的维护和管理需要较高的技术门槛,尤其是在大规模集群中。

针对这些挑战,社区和企业提供了丰富的工具和解决方案,如Helm用于简化应用部署,Prometheus和Grafana用于监控,以及各种Managed Kubernetes服务,如AWS EKS、Azure AKS等,降低了使用门槛。

未来展望

随着云原生技术的不断发展,Kubernetes将继续演进,提供更加智能化、自动化的功能,随着边缘计算、物联网等新兴技术的兴起,Kubernetes的应用场景将进一步拓展。

Kubernetes作为现代应用的基石,已经成为企业数字化转型的重要支撑,掌握Kubernetes技术,不仅能提升应用的部署和管理效率,还能为企业的创新和发展提供强有力的保障。

相关关键词

Kubernetes, 容器编排, 微服务, 云原生, CI/CD, 负载均衡, 服务发现, 自动化部署, 回滚, 存储编排, 自我修复, 密钥管理, 配置管理, Master节点, Node节点, Pod, Helm, Prometheus, Grafana, AWS EKS, Azure AKS, 边缘计算, 物联网, 大数据处理, Spark, Hadoop, 学习曲线, 运维复杂, 声明式配置, DNS名, Kubelet, Kube-proxy, API Server, Scheduler, Controller Manager, Secret, ConfigMap, 云计算, 数字化转型, 高可用性, 资源调度, 灵活性, 可扩展性, 开源, Google, Borg系统, Managed Kubernetes服务

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Kubernetes容器编排平台:kubernetes容器化

原文链接:,转发请注明来源!